Directions:

  1. Cook the eggs first, and then cool, once cool use an egg slicer twice on each egg; first time one way, second time the other.
  2. Then cook the potatoes, and then cool.
  3. While potatoes are cooking, make a mixture kind of like egg salad using the cooked eggs. Combine mayonnaise, yellow mustard, sweet relish and onions. Make sure the mixture is moist to coat the potatoes. (taste test, added more mayo or mustard if needed).
  4. It's always better to have too much than not enough….
  5. NOTE: it never turns out the same twice, but it always disappears.
